This section describes how to install Air Manager.

Windows

1. Download Air Manager

Download Air Manager here.

2. Install Air Manager

Run the downloaded executable and follow the on-screen instructions.

By default, Air Manager will install in the "Program Files" folder. A shortcut will be created on the desktop.

3. (Optional) Install the Flight Simulator plugin(s)

In order to connect Air Manager to your flight simulator, you have to install our plugin to your Flight Simualtor.
Information on how to install the flight simulator plugins can be found here.

Mac OS

1. Download Air Manager

Download Air Manager here.

2. Install Air Manager

Mount the downloaded image, and drag the AirManager.app file to your application folder.

You can now start AirManager.app from your applications folder.

Linux

Info Air Manager V3 installation only works on Debian distributions that support apt-get

Follow these steps to install Linux on your Linux distribution.

1. Download Air Manager

Download Air Manager here.

2. Unzip the downloaded Air Manager package somewhere on your Linux system

3. Run the included Linux setup. This will install libraries Air Manager needs to operate

chmod +x Setup.sh
sudo ./Setup.sh

4. Start Air Manager

./Bootloader
